# Maestro-competitive roadmap — completion report

**Status: all 19 items complete** (2026-08-15). This is the consolidated summary; per-item detail,
caveats, and honest limitations live in each item's entry in
[`maestro-competitive-roadmap.md`](maestro-competitive-roadmap.md) and its linked
`docs/evidence/` folder. Shipped across releases **v0.11.0 → v0.13.0**.

## Phase 0 — Correctness (shipped in v0.11.0)

| Item | What shipped |
|---|---|
| R-1 | Tap-family verbs now resolve `<var>` placeholders in their selectors (previously only `type`/`see` did) |
| R-3 / PT-27 | Android reconnection token survives OS cache clearing — the periodic re-print now also re-writes the token file |
| R-4 | `see #field contains "…"` reads `EditableText` controllers, not just `Text`/`RichText` |
| V-1 / PT-03 | Scroll targeting re-verified holding on real devices (stacked-route Scrollables) |
| R-5 | `dump tree` / `save device logs` parse correctly (dangling-token misparse fixed) |

## Native UI Automation

Android is currently the only platform where probe can reach **outside the Flutter widget tree**
into native, OS-owned UI — pickers, share sheets, and any other surface the Dart agent can never
see. Elements are matched against uiautomator's text or resource-id and driven via
`uiautomator dump` + `input tap`/`input text` — no new dependencies, `adb` already ships both:

```
tap native "Choose from Gallery"
see native "IMG_0001.jpg"
don't see native "Error"
type native "wifi" into "Search settings"
```

Notes from real-device verification:

- Matching is a case-insensitive substring against both `text` and `resource-id`.
- If the native element is reached via a screen transition, add a `wait` step first — the same
idiom used after Flutter navigation.
- `take a screenshot` (the Dart-agent verb) cannot capture native UI — it renders only Flutter's
own tree. Use `adb exec-out screencap` externally to visually verify native state.
- API 35 pitfall for your own native screens: forced edge-to-edge can place a top-of-screen
element's reported bounds center underneath the app bar, which silently eats the tap — handle
window insets (`fitsSystemWindows` or equivalent).

A purpose-built native fixture app with stable ids lives in the repo under `native-test-apps/`.

## Device Media

```
add media "fixtures/photo.jpg" # adb push + MEDIA_SCANNER_SCAN_FILE broadcast
```

The file lands in `/sdcard/Pictures/` and is MediaStore-indexed, so it is genuinely visible to
image pickers — combine with the native UI verbs above to actually select it.

## Deep Links

```
open link "myapp://profile/42" in the app
```

Dispatches `am start -a android.intent.action.VIEW`, so a custom scheme or App Links URL
registered by your app is delivered to the app itself — including cold-launching it from fully
terminated (unlike iOS Simulator; see the iOS page). Plain `open link "https://..."` (no suffix)
still opens the external browser via `url_launcher`.

:::note[Permission changes relaunch the app (v0.12.1+)]
`simctl privacy grant/revoke` silently **terminates the target app** — an Apple behavior, not a
probe one. As of v0.12.1, all four permission verbs automatically relaunch the app and reconnect
the session afterward, so a permission step costs a few seconds of restart instead of hanging the
next step. Follow a permission step with `wait until "<your screen>" appears` before asserting,
exactly as you would after `restart the app`.
:::

## Device Media

```
add media "fixtures/photo.jpg" # xcrun simctl addmedia
```

The file lands in the simulator's Photos library and is immediately visible to image pickers.
Simulators only — there is no `devicectl` equivalent for physical devices; the step skips with a
warning there.

## Deep Links

```
open link "myapp://profile/42" in the app
```

Dispatches `xcrun simctl openurl`, so a custom scheme or Universal Link registered by your app is
delivered to the app itself. Plain `open link "https://..."` still opens Safari via
`url_launcher`.

:::caution[No cold launch on iOS Simulator]
`simctl openurl` cannot launch a fully-terminated app — iOS shows an "Open in App?" confirmation
dialog that `simctl` has no way to dismiss. Deep links work reliably when the app is already
running (foreground or backgrounded); put a `restart the app` or equivalent warm-up before the
deep-link step if the app might not be running. Android has no such caveat.
:::

## Native UI Automation

The `tap native` / `see native` / `type native` verbs are **Android-only today** — iOS has no
`uiautomator` equivalent, and `simctl` cannot inspect or drive arbitrary UI. On iOS,
`tap native`/`type native` fail with a clear error rather than silently no-op'ing, and
`see native` reports "not found". iOS support via WebDriverAgent is a written, scoped proposal
(`docs/proposals/n2-ios-native-ui-bridging.md` in the repo), not yet implemented.
